Nelli Lyyra
nelli.lyyra@utu.fi +358 29 450 3039 +358 50 465 6593 |
- Four scales measuring mental wellbeing in the Nordic countries: do they tell the same story? (2025)
- Health and Quality of Life Outcomes
Nelli Lyyra
nelli.lyyra@utu.fi +358 29 450 3039 +358 50 465 6593 |